H. R. Park is a scholar working on Biomedical Engineering, Electrical and Electronic Engineering and Atomic and Molecular Physics, and Optics. According to data from OpenAlex, H. R. Park has authored 5 papers receiving a total of 579 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Biomedical Engineering, 3 papers in Electrical and Electronic Engineering and 2 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in H. R. Park’s work include Plasmonic and Surface Plasmon Research (4 papers), Metamaterials and Metasurfaces Applications (2 papers) and Photonic Crystals and Applications (2 papers). H. R. Park is often cited by papers focused on Plasmonic and Surface Plasmon Research (4 papers), Metamaterials and Metasurfaces Applications (2 papers) and Photonic Crystals and Applications (2 papers). H. R. Park collaborates with scholars based in South Korea, United States and Germany. H. R. Park's co-authors include D. S. Kim, Do Joon Park, Namkyoo Park, Minah Seo, S. M. Koo, Seong Soo Choi, P. C. M. Planken, Q. H. Park, O. K. Suwal and Ju Hyung Kang and has published in prestigious journals such as Physical Review Letters, Applied Physics Letters and Nature Photonics.
